        Special Operations Forces destroy DPRK platoon in close combat in Kursk region (video)

        Special Operations Forces soldiers destroyed a platoon of DPRK troops during an operation in the Kursk region of Russia.

        During the rapid contact, the Special Operations Forces operators killed 25 North Koreans, the Special Operations Forces Command reports.

        Special forces of the 6th Ranger Regiment went to the enemy’s rear positions in an armoured Humvee. After detecting the enemy unit, the Ukrainian military took up firing positions in the trenches and engaged in close combat with a platoon of North Korean soldiers.

        In total, eight Ukrainian Special Forces took part in the battle against 25 DPRK soldiers. Despite the enemy’s numerical superiority and artillery fire, the Ukrainian military destroyed the enemy unit.

        The Ukrainian Armed Forces stressed that the operation took place last month, but due to operational security, they have only just released the video of the battle.
